‘No fuel for Americans!’: Norwegian Giant Halts US Sales After Trump-Zelensky Clash

ALWAGHT- Norwegian fuel company Haltbakk Bunkers has reportedly declared a ban on fuel sales to all US forces following the public dispute between President Donald Trump and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ky at the White House.

Haltbakk Bunkers, a major Norwegian fuel company, announced on social media its decision to halt fuel sales to US forces, expressing support for Ukrainian President Zelensky. The company criticized the US leadership, calling the confrontation between President Trump and Zelensky the "greatest 'sh*t show'" ever broadcast live. They praised Zelensky for maintaining composure during the public dispute.

The company's CEO, Gunnar Gran, explained that Haltbakk Bunkers, which supplied 3 million liters of fuel to the US military in 2024, made the decision immediately after witnessing the clash. Gran emphasized that the company selects its customers and would no longer provide fuel to the US military, calling for other firms in Norway and Europe to follow suit in isolating the United States.

The dispute occurred when Zelensky visited the White House, intending to sign a mineral deal, but left without an agreement. Trump and Vice President JD Vance criticized Zelensky for what they perceived as a lack of gratitude for previous US support, with Trump warning Zelensky about the consequences of his actions.
